New xcursor-themes packages with cursor themes from xorg 7.0. ok sturm@

This commit is contained in:
matthieu 2006-02-04 10:32:21 +00:00
parent 1c1baa10ee
commit 0b0921d752
5 changed files with 204 additions and 0 deletions

View File

@ -0,0 +1,31 @@
# $OpenBSD: Makefile,v 1.1.1.1 2006/02/04 10:32:21 matthieu Exp $
COMMENT= "X11 Cursors themes"
VERSION= 1.0.1
DISTNAME= xcursor-themes-X11R7.0-${VERSION}
PKGNAME= xcursor-themes-${VERSION}
CATEGORIES= x11
HOMEPAGE= http://wiki.X.Org/
MAINTAINER= Matthieu Herrb <matthieu@openbsd.org>
BUILD_DEPENDS= :xcursorgen->=7:x11/xcursorgen \
:pkgconfig-*:devel/pkgconfig
# X11
PERMIT_PACKAGE_CDROM= Yes
PERMIT_PACKAGE_FTP= Yes
PERMIT_DISTFILES_CDROM= Yes
PERMIT_DISTFILES_FTP= Yrs
MASTER_SITES= ftp://ftp.x.org/pub/X11R7.0/src/data/
SEPARATE_BUILD= concurrent
USE_X11= Yes
CONFIGURE_STYLE= gnu
CONFIGURE_ENV= LOCALBASE="${LOCALBASE}"
NO_REGRESS= Yes
.include <bsd.port.mk>

View File

@ -0,0 +1,4 @@
MD5 (xcursor-themes-X11R7.0-1.0.1.tar.gz) = 26ac226ac6021678e5904584e0eb556f
RMD160 (xcursor-themes-X11R7.0-1.0.1.tar.gz) = 3f2f38f134dd9967bc7ebac23018e976434a24d8
SHA1 (xcursor-themes-X11R7.0-1.0.1.tar.gz) = 3ad43cecbe4b83ced040c9481682d2d54bce80b9
SIZE (xcursor-themes-X11R7.0-1.0.1.tar.gz) = 2431106

View File

@ -0,0 +1,14 @@
$OpenBSD: patch-configure,v 1.1.1.1 2006/02/04 10:32:21 matthieu Exp $
--- configure.orig Sun Jan 8 14:44:52 2006
+++ configure Sun Jan 8 14:44:52 2006
@@ -3232,8 +3232,8 @@
echo "${ECHO_T}yes" >&6
:
fi
-cursordir=$(pkg-config --variable=icondir xcursor)
-
+#cursordir=$(pkg-config --variable=icondir xcursor)
+cursordir=${LOCALBASE}/lib/X11/icons

View File

@ -0,0 +1,23 @@
xcursor-themes - cursors images for the X window system.
The package comes with three cursor themes : 'redglass', 'whiteglass'
and 'handhelds'. Additionally selecting the 'core' theme switches back
to the traditional X server "core" cursors.
To use the new cursors
- set the environment variable XCURSOR_PATH to
"~/.icons:${PREFIX}/lib/X11/icons"
- either :
a) set the XCURSOR_THEME environment variable to one of the theme names
b) create ~/.icons/default/index.theme containing (for example to use
the whiteglass theme):
-- Cut --
[Icon Theme]
Inherits=whiteglass
-- Cut --
The XCURSOR_SIZE environment variable can be used to set the size of
the cursors.

View File

@ -0,0 +1,132 @@
@comment $OpenBSD: PLIST,v 1.1.1.1 2006/02/04 10:32:21 matthieu Exp $
lib/X11/icons/
lib/X11/icons/handhelds/
lib/X11/icons/handhelds/cursors/
lib/X11/icons/handhelds/cursors/X_cursor
lib/X11/icons/handhelds/cursors/based_arrow_down
lib/X11/icons/handhelds/cursors/based_arrow_up
lib/X11/icons/handhelds/cursors/bottom_left_corner
lib/X11/icons/handhelds/cursors/bottom_right_corner
lib/X11/icons/handhelds/cursors/bottom_side
lib/X11/icons/handhelds/cursors/bottom_tee
lib/X11/icons/handhelds/cursors/center_ptr
lib/X11/icons/handhelds/cursors/circle
lib/X11/icons/handhelds/cursors/cross
lib/X11/icons/handhelds/cursors/dot
lib/X11/icons/handhelds/cursors/dotbox
lib/X11/icons/handhelds/cursors/double_arrow
lib/X11/icons/handhelds/cursors/draped_box
lib/X11/icons/handhelds/cursors/fleur
lib/X11/icons/handhelds/cursors/gumby
lib/X11/icons/handhelds/cursors/hand2
lib/X11/icons/handhelds/cursors/left_ptr
lib/X11/icons/handhelds/cursors/left_ptr_watch
lib/X11/icons/handhelds/cursors/left_side
lib/X11/icons/handhelds/cursors/left_tee
lib/X11/icons/handhelds/cursors/ll_angle
lib/X11/icons/handhelds/cursors/pencil
lib/X11/icons/handhelds/cursors/right_ptr
lib/X11/icons/handhelds/cursors/right_side
lib/X11/icons/handhelds/cursors/right_tee
lib/X11/icons/handhelds/cursors/sb_h_double_arrow
lib/X11/icons/handhelds/cursors/sb_right_arrow
lib/X11/icons/handhelds/cursors/sb_up_arrow
lib/X11/icons/handhelds/cursors/sb_v_double_arrow
lib/X11/icons/handhelds/cursors/shuttle
lib/X11/icons/handhelds/cursors/top_left_corner
lib/X11/icons/handhelds/cursors/top_right_corner
lib/X11/icons/handhelds/cursors/top_side
lib/X11/icons/handhelds/cursors/top_tee
lib/X11/icons/handhelds/cursors/watch
lib/X11/icons/handhelds/cursors/xterm
lib/X11/icons/redglass/
lib/X11/icons/redglass/cursors/
lib/X11/icons/redglass/cursors/X_cursor
lib/X11/icons/redglass/cursors/based_arrow_down
lib/X11/icons/redglass/cursors/based_arrow_up
lib/X11/icons/redglass/cursors/bottom_left_corner
lib/X11/icons/redglass/cursors/bottom_right_corner
lib/X11/icons/redglass/cursors/bottom_side
lib/X11/icons/redglass/cursors/bottom_tee
lib/X11/icons/redglass/cursors/center_ptr
lib/X11/icons/redglass/cursors/circle
lib/X11/icons/redglass/cursors/cross
lib/X11/icons/redglass/cursors/dot
lib/X11/icons/redglass/cursors/dotbox
lib/X11/icons/redglass/cursors/double_arrow
lib/X11/icons/redglass/cursors/draped_box
lib/X11/icons/redglass/cursors/fleur
lib/X11/icons/redglass/cursors/gumby
lib/X11/icons/redglass/cursors/hand2
lib/X11/icons/redglass/cursors/left_ptr
lib/X11/icons/redglass/cursors/left_ptr_watch
lib/X11/icons/redglass/cursors/left_side
lib/X11/icons/redglass/cursors/left_tee
lib/X11/icons/redglass/cursors/ll_angle
lib/X11/icons/redglass/cursors/pencil
lib/X11/icons/redglass/cursors/right_ptr
lib/X11/icons/redglass/cursors/right_side
lib/X11/icons/redglass/cursors/right_tee
lib/X11/icons/redglass/cursors/sb_h_double_arrow
lib/X11/icons/redglass/cursors/sb_right_arrow
lib/X11/icons/redglass/cursors/sb_up_arrow
lib/X11/icons/redglass/cursors/sb_v_double_arrow
lib/X11/icons/redglass/cursors/shuttle
lib/X11/icons/redglass/cursors/top_left_corner
lib/X11/icons/redglass/cursors/top_right_corner
lib/X11/icons/redglass/cursors/top_side
lib/X11/icons/redglass/cursors/top_tee
lib/X11/icons/redglass/cursors/xterm
lib/X11/icons/whiteglass/
lib/X11/icons/whiteglass/cursors/
lib/X11/icons/whiteglass/cursors/X_cursor
lib/X11/icons/whiteglass/cursors/base_arrow_down
lib/X11/icons/whiteglass/cursors/base_arrow_up
lib/X11/icons/whiteglass/cursors/boat
lib/X11/icons/whiteglass/cursors/bottom_left_corner
lib/X11/icons/whiteglass/cursors/bottom_right_corner
lib/X11/icons/whiteglass/cursors/bottom_side
lib/X11/icons/whiteglass/cursors/bottom_tee
lib/X11/icons/whiteglass/cursors/center_ptr
lib/X11/icons/whiteglass/cursors/circle
lib/X11/icons/whiteglass/cursors/cross
lib/X11/icons/whiteglass/cursors/dot
lib/X11/icons/whiteglass/cursors/dot_box_mask
lib/X11/icons/whiteglass/cursors/double_arrow
lib/X11/icons/whiteglass/cursors/draped_box
lib/X11/icons/whiteglass/cursors/exchange
lib/X11/icons/whiteglass/cursors/fleur
lib/X11/icons/whiteglass/cursors/gumby
lib/X11/icons/whiteglass/cursors/hand1
lib/X11/icons/whiteglass/cursors/hand2
lib/X11/icons/whiteglass/cursors/left_ptr
lib/X11/icons/whiteglass/cursors/left_ptr_watch
lib/X11/icons/whiteglass/cursors/left_side
lib/X11/icons/whiteglass/cursors/left_tee
lib/X11/icons/whiteglass/cursors/ll_angle
lib/X11/icons/whiteglass/cursors/lr_angle
lib/X11/icons/whiteglass/cursors/pencil
lib/X11/icons/whiteglass/cursors/pirate
lib/X11/icons/whiteglass/cursors/question_arrow
lib/X11/icons/whiteglass/cursors/right_ptr
lib/X11/icons/whiteglass/cursors/right_side
lib/X11/icons/whiteglass/cursors/right_tee
lib/X11/icons/whiteglass/cursors/sailboat
lib/X11/icons/whiteglass/cursors/sb_down_arrow
lib/X11/icons/whiteglass/cursors/sb_h_double_arrow
lib/X11/icons/whiteglass/cursors/sb_left_arrow
lib/X11/icons/whiteglass/cursors/sb_right_arrow
lib/X11/icons/whiteglass/cursors/sb_up_arrow
lib/X11/icons/whiteglass/cursors/sb_v_double_arrow
lib/X11/icons/whiteglass/cursors/shuttle
lib/X11/icons/whiteglass/cursors/sizing
lib/X11/icons/whiteglass/cursors/target
lib/X11/icons/whiteglass/cursors/top_left_corner
lib/X11/icons/whiteglass/cursors/top_right_corner
lib/X11/icons/whiteglass/cursors/top_side
lib/X11/icons/whiteglass/cursors/top_tee
lib/X11/icons/whiteglass/cursors/trek
lib/X11/icons/whiteglass/cursors/ul_angle
lib/X11/icons/whiteglass/cursors/ur_angle
lib/X11/icons/whiteglass/cursors/watch
lib/X11/icons/whiteglass/cursors/xterm